This week, the Macrocast team examines the Federal Reserve's latest policy meeting, where Chair Kevin Walsh held rates steady while maintaining his stance against forward guidance, a decision that drove Treasury yields higher and weighed on equities. The team discusses why the rate hold met expectations, yet a lack of clarity on inflation metrics and the Fed's decision-making framework left markets and analysts wanting more.

The episode also covers steady policy from the Bank of Japan and Bank of England, the market impact of a major hedge fund's liquidation of AI-related positions, and MAG7 earnings that showed strong profitability alongside growing scrutiny of capital spending and reporting transparency. The team closes with a look at economic data on both sides of the Atlantic and key developments in Washington on government funding and Russia sanctions.
